I work on the biodiversity crisis in semi-natural terrestrial environments, and on how economic public policy could manage it more effectively. My approach brings together ecology, economics, philosophy and research-creation. I make a point of publishing within each discipline, to root my work in its respective research communities and to test the validity of interdisciplinary research. I founded and lead the BIOECON group at CIRED, which brings together researchers and PhD students around bioeconomic modelling and its epistemological stakes.
I develop a bioeconomic model that couples ecological dynamics with economic decisions — without routing them through a monetary value of nature. The coupling runs through biophysical processes instead. Applied to more than 600 small agricultural regions across France, the model makes it possible to assess how agricultural policies affect biodiversity, and vice versa.
Behind every economic model lie philosophical choices. I examine the ethical foundations of the economics–ecology interface: what does it actually mean to "value" nature? Which conceptions of the human–nature relationship underpin our policies? And how might the notion of planetary boundaries frame our decisions?
How does art catalyse the relationships between science and society? I explore this through research-creation: producing an art-science object for public engagement and analysing it, but also letting artistic practice interrogate research itself. This reflexive strand unfolds at the interface with my own artistic practice (see Studio, textile and digital arts) and in collaboration with other artists.
